Volta a la Comunitat Valenciana 2018, BMC conquers the team time trial

BMC Racing wins the team time trial at Volta a Comunitat Valenciana 2018. The success of the men directed by Jim Ochowitz has although a bittersweet taste because of the neutralization of the gaps pointed out on the finish line. In facts, due to the hostile weather conditions, the organizers decided that today’s stage would not count towards the general classification. This decision is the result of a compromise reached by the organization and the teams, despite some of the latters have shown their dissent.

The stage takes place over 23,5 kms instead of the 30 kms between Poble Nou de Benitatxell and Calpe originally planned. BMC stops the clock after 27’25” of race, with an average speed which goes beyond 50 kms per hour. In the back of the American team Astana with 1’08” of delay, Ag2r La Mondiale with 1’12”, Gazprom – Rusvelo and CCC – Sprandi both finished after 1’36” complete the top-5 of the day. Any change affects the general classification, where Alejandro Valverde (Movistar) foreruns Luis Leon Sanchez and Jakob Fuglsang of Astana respectively by 4 and 6 seconds.
